package engine import ( "math/rand" "time" "github.com/deluan/gosonic/domain" "github.com/deluan/gosonic/utils" ) // TODO Use Entries instead of Albums type ListGenerator interface { GetNewest(offset int, size int) (domain.Albums, error) GetRecent(offset int, size int) (domain.Albums, error) GetFrequent(offset int, size int) (domain.Albums, error) GetHighest(offset int, size int) (domain.Albums, error) GetRandom(offset int, size int) (domain.Albums, error) GetStarred() (Entries, error) GetNowPlaying() (Entries, error) } func NewListGenerator(alr domain.AlbumRepository, mfr domain.MediaFileRepository, npr NowPlayingRepository) ListGenerator { return listGenerator{alr, mfr, npr} } type listGenerator struct { albumRepo domain.AlbumRepository mfRepository domain.MediaFileRepository npRepo NowPlayingRepository } func (g listGenerator) query(qo domain.QueryOptions, offset int, size int) (domain.Albums, error) { qo.Offset = offset qo.Size = size return g.albumRepo.GetAll(qo) } func (g listGenerator) GetNewest(offset int, size int) (domain.Albums, error) { qo := domain.QueryOptions{SortBy: "CreatedAt", Desc: true, Alpha: true} return g.query(qo, offset, size) } func (g listGenerator) GetRecent(offset int, size int) (domain.Albums, error) { qo := domain.QueryOptions{SortBy: "PlayDate", Desc: true, Alpha: true} return g.query(qo, offset, size) } func (g listGenerator) GetFrequent(offset int, size int) (domain.Albums, error) { qo := domain.QueryOptions{SortBy: "PlayCount", Desc: true} return g.query(qo, offset, size) } func (g listGenerator) GetHighest(offset int, size int) (domain.Albums, error) { qo := domain.QueryOptions{SortBy: "Rating", Desc: true} return g.query(qo, offset, size) } func (g listGenerator) GetRandom(offset int, size int) (domain.Albums, error) { ids, err := g.albumRepo.GetAllIds() if err != nil { return nil, err } size = utils.MinInt(size, len(ids)) perm := rand.Perm(size) r := make(domain.Albums, size) for i := 0; i < size; i++ { v := perm[i] al, err := g.albumRepo.Get((ids)[v]) if err != nil { return nil, err } r[i] = *al } return r, nil } func (g listGenerator) GetStarred() (Entries, error) { albums, err := g.albumRepo.GetStarred(domain.QueryOptions{}) if err != nil { return nil, err } entries := make(Entries, len(albums)) for i, al := range albums { entries[i] = FromAlbum(&al) } return entries, nil } func (g listGenerator) GetNowPlaying() (Entries, error) { npInfo, err := g.npRepo.GetAll() if err != nil { return nil, err } entries := make(Entries, len(*npInfo)) for i, np := range *npInfo { mf, err := g.mfRepository.Get(np.TrackId) if err != nil { return nil, err } entries[i] = FromMediaFile(mf) entries[i].UserName = np.Username entries[i].MinutesAgo = int(time.Now().Sub(np.Start).Minutes()) entries[i].PlayerId = np.PlayerId entries[i].PlayerName = np.PlayerName } return entries, nil }
